GTT Announces Exciting Fibre Promotion – Faster Fibre!

Guyana Telephone & Telegraph (GTT), Guyana’s largest, fastest, and most reliable network, is thrilled to unveil “Faster Fibre”, a promotion designed to reward valued customers. With GTT Fibre, customers not only experience lightning-fast internet speeds but are now also treated to exclusive rewards, including fuel, grocery, and food vouchers, alongside a chance to win one of ten 65″ TV in weekly draws ending June 30, 2024.

All customers need to do is sign up for fibre once they are in Fibre ready areas or upgrade their existing plans to higher tiers to instantly enjoy the benefits of this exciting promotion.

GTT is pleased to announce that two lucky winners have already been chosen for this promotion. Debra DeSousa and Elizabeth Chase are now the proud recipients of brand-new 65″ TVs, courtesy of GTT.

Sharing their excitement, Debra expressed, “I am overjoyed to have won this amazing prize from GTT. Now in addition to the amazing connectivity with GTT Fibre, I can now enjoy my new smart TV.”

Similarly, Elizabeth Chase exclaimed, “Winning this TV came at the right now as I recently finished construction of my new home, I already have a place for it!”
